The military campaigns in 1918 played a crucial role. The Allied forces launched a series of coordinated attacks. For example, the Hundred Days Offensive pushed the German lines back. At the same time, the German military was in a weakened state. Their economy was crumbling, and they were having trouble maintaining their war effort. These military and economic factors were important events leading up to the armistice in 1918.

The Armistice of 11 November 1918 marked the end of World War I. It came after years of brutal fighting. Essentially, the Central Powers were exhausted militarily and economically. Germany, in particular, faced internal unrest and could no longer sustain the war effort. Negotiations led to the armistice, which was a cease - fire agreement. It was signed in a railway carriage in Compiègne, France. This event signaled the beginning of the end for the old empires that had participated in the war and set the stage for the Treaty of Versailles, which would reshape Europe and the world in many ways.
